CIEG 414 - Railroad Geotechnical Engineering Credit(s): 3 RAILROAD GEOTECH ENGINEERING Component: Lecture Designing, constructing, maintaining railway track. Developing railway track substructure: materials, mechanics, drainage, loading, slopes, design, maintenance, measurements and management and case studies. Track substructure issues related to load freight and high speed passenger rail traffic. Repeatable for Credit: N Allowed Units: 3 Multiple Term Enrollment: N Grading Basis: Student Option PREREQ: MATH 351 and CIEG 212 or equivalent. COREQ: MATH 353 and CIEG 301 or permission of instructor. General Education Objectives: GE5A: Reason Quantitatively GE5B: Reason Computationally
